Distillation Distillation units read more provide chemical and microbial purification by way of thermal vaporization, mist elimination, and drinking water vapor condensation. Several different layouts is accessible which include one influence, various impact, and vapor compression. The latter two configurations are Generally Employed in more substantial techniques as a consequence of their generating capacity and efficiency. Distilled drinking water devices have to have diverse feed h2o controls than required by membrane methods. For distillation, due consideration has to be provided to prior removal of hardness and silica impurities that could foul or corrode the heat transfer surfaces along with prior removal of Those people impurities that might volatize and condense combined with the water vapor.
